Final Examination. 1. The thesis will be defended during an oral examination to be held at one of the universities of the Consortium. 2. The defence shall take place in public before the Defence committee pointed out by the Committee and approved by the Board. 3. The doctoral candidate shall defend the thesis against the objections of the Defence committee for one academic hour. 4. The Defence committee shall be composed of five members. Among them, two referees should be external to the Academic Committee (international scholars expert in the field). The thesis will be written in English.
